As another top cable choice offered by OneStopBuy.com through Belden and Alpha Cable, Variable Frequency Flexible Drive Cables are heavily relied upon for industrial purposes. One of their most important features is that they provide the ability for 3-phase AC electronic motor speeds to be changed in sync with the change of a motor load. Because of this, Variable Frequency Drive (VFD) cable allows the RPM on an industrial motor application to be ered alongside adjustments in output voltage and frequency levels.

Aside from a greater level of control over electronic processes, Variable Frequency Drive cables are known for generating a greater amount of energy savings and increasing the reliability, precision, and efficiency of induction motors in plants by preventing as much wear-and-tear from use. The typical design, which includes pulse width modulation, functions with motors of various power and sizes. Variable Frequency Drive cable also typically has tolerance levels of within 0.1% and can enable motors to run at levels lower than their maximum speeds.

Finding the Right VFD Cable Match

The first things to bear in mind when selecting a Variable Frequency Drive cable is that there are special requirements and characteristics for every load. Understand the nature and requirements of the load. Your cable must have a high enough current capacity to stay in line with a load’s torque, speed, and power abilities. By choosing the most appropriate VFD cable, you can also benefit from lower levels of noise, a reduction in voltage reflections, and a lowered risk of repairs needed due to failed motor cables.

 From Belden and Alpha, there are basically two varieties of Variable Frequency Drive cable: those graded for construction and another rated for high performance. Construction-grade VFD cables are characterized by a more minimal level of conformity to UL and CSA standards for Tray Cable. Their construction usually consists of a single layer of copper tape for shielding. Construction-grade Variable Frequency Drive cords bare also meet NEC requirements.

On the other hand, high-performance VFD cables are more intended for applications that have a need for guarding against noise levels. As a result of their more powerful ground and shielding systems, their lower ground impedance levels can be almost as much as three times lower. A flexible stranding and tinned conductors provide greater surface area coverage, better high-frequency performance, and improved connections.

Preventing Damage to Motors and Cable Wear

Unless you have the right type of cable in a VFD application, voltage wave can be reflected back from motors, thus producing enormously high voltage levels in conductors. Aside from the possible issue of in-service motor failure, excessive wear on motor bearings, and damage to drives, there is also the added concern that cables could be damaged from this misuse over the long term. Failures of these sort will inevitably lead to whole systems being brought down, with downtime in production being the worst consequence.
